Как программировать базы данных в Excel — полезные советы и трюки

Программирование баз данных Excel — это процесс разработки и создания структурированных и эффективных баз данных, которые позволяют пользователям хранить, организовывать и управлять большим количеством данных в программе Excel.

Excel — одно из самых популярных приложений для работы с электронными таблицами, и программирование баз данных Excel предоставляет пользователю возможность создавать сложные формулы, макросы и функции, которые позволяют автоматизировать процессы и упростить работу с данными.

Программирование баз данных Excel имеет множество применений в различных областях, таких как финансы, учет, логистика, продажи и маркетинг. Оно помогает организациям улучшить эффективность работы, упростить анализ данных и принимать обоснованные решения на основе надежной информации.

В процессе программирования баз данных Excel можно использовать различные инструменты и технологии, такие как язык программирования VBA (Visual Basic for Applications), SQL (Structured Query Language) и специальные функции Excel. Эти инструменты позволяют создавать пользовательские формы, фильтры, сводные таблицы и другие элементы, которые помогают в обработке и анализе данных.

Знание программирования баз данных Excel может быть полезно для любого, кто работает с данными и хочет повысить свою профессиональную эффективность. Оно позволяет создавать мощные и гибкие инструменты для работы с данными, что может существенно улучшить управление информацией и принятие решений.

В статье «Программирование баз данных Excel» мы рассмотрим основные понятия и принципы программирования баз данных в Excel, а также приведем примеры и рекомендации по созданию эффективных баз данных и использованию программных возможностей Excel для работы с данными.

Зачем программировать базы данных в Excel?

Программирование баз данных в Excel может внести значительные улучшения в работу с данными и повысить эффективность и продуктивность работы с электронными таблицами. Возможности программирования дозволяют автоматизировать процессы, оптимизировать анализ данных и создавать персонализированные отчеты и дашборды.

Одной из причин, почему программирование баз данных в Excel может быть полезным, является возможность создания пользовательских форм и макросов. С помощью макросов и VBA (Visual Basic for Applications) можно автоматизировать повторяющиеся задачи, такие как импорт данных из других источников, обработка и анализ данных, построение графиков и диаграмм. Это позволяет сэкономить много времени и сил, освободить себя от монотонных и рутинных операций.

Еще одна причина программировать базы данных в Excel — возможность создания сложных отчетов и аналитических инструментов. Программирование позволяет создавать пользовательские функции, которые могут выполнять сложные вычисления, фильтровать и сортировать данные, а также строить сводные таблицы для анализа и визуализации данных. Это особенно полезно для бизнес-аналитики и менеджмента, которым необходимо оперативно получать информацию о состоянии дел и прогнозировать будущие тренды и результаты.

Читайте также:  D3dx9 43 dll windows vista

В целом, программирование баз данных в Excel — это мощный инструмент для управления данными и повышения продуктивности работы с электронными таблицами. Оно позволяет автоматизировать задачи, создавать пользовательские отчеты и инструменты анализа данных, что значительно упрощает и ускоряет работу пользователей с Excel.

Преимущества программирования баз данных в Excel:

  • Автоматизация повторяющихся задач
  • Создание пользовательских макросов и форм
  • Создание сложных отчетов и аналитических инструментов
  • Оптимизация работы с данными и повышение продуктивности

Преимущества программирования баз данных в Excel

Одно из главных преимуществ программирования баз данных в Excel заключается в возможности автоматизации повторяющихся задач. Базы данных помогают организовать и хранить большие объемы информации, и программирование позволяет создать скрипты, которые автоматически выполняют заданные операции. Например, можно написать скрипт, который будет автоматически обновлять данные из внешних источников или создавать отчеты на основе определенных критериев. Это значительно экономит время и снижает вероятность ошибок при выполнении рутиных задач.

Основные принципы программирования баз данных в Excel

1. Планирование и структурирование данных

Перед тем как начать программировать базу данных в Excel, необходимо разработать план и определить структуру данных. Это включает в себя определение типов данных, создание таблиц и связей между ними. Планирование и структурирование данных помогает упорядочить информацию и обеспечить эффективную работу с базой данных.

2. Использование функций и формул Excel

Excel предлагает широкий набор функций и формул, которые могут быть использованы при программировании базы данных. Например, функция VLOOKUP позволяет искать значения в определенном диапазоне, а формулы SUM и AVERAGE используются для расчетов и агрегирования данных. Умение использовать эти функции и формулы поможет упростить и автоматизировать работу с данными.

3. Создание макросов и пользовательских форм

Макросы и пользовательские формы являются мощными инструментами, которые позволяют автоматизировать задачи и упростить процесс работы с базой данных. Макросы позволяют записывать и воспроизводить серию действий, тогда как пользовательские формы предоставляют пользователю удобный интерфейс для ввода данных. Создание макросов и пользовательских форм позволит сделать программирование и использование базы данных в Excel более эффективным и удобным.

В конечном итоге, программирование баз данных в Excel является важным навыком, который может улучшить процесс работы с данными и сделать его более эффективным. Понимание основных принципов этого процесса поможет вам справиться с задачами и достичь желаемых результатов.

Выбор языка программирования для работы с базами данных в Excel

В мире программирования существует множество языков, и выбор подходящего для работы с базами данных в Excel может быть довольно сложным. Каждый язык имеет свои особенности и предоставляет различные инструменты и функциональные возможности для работы с данными. В данной статье мы рассмотрим некоторые из наиболее популярных языков, которые могут быть полезны при работе с базами данных в Excel.

1. VBA (Visual Basic for Applications)

Читайте также:  Как перевести изображение в Word - подробный гайд и лучшие способы

Один из наиболее распространенных языков программирования для работы с базами данных в Excel является VBA. VBA позволяет автоматизировать задачи в Excel, создавать и редактировать базы данных, а также выполнять сложные вычисления и манипуляции с данными. Он интегрирован в Excel и предоставляет доступ ко всем функциям и возможностям программы.

2. Python

Python — это язык программирования, который также может быть использован для работы с базами данных в Excel. С помощью библиотеки pandas можно эффективно работать с таблицами данных в Excel, а библиотека xlrd позволяет читать данные из Excel файлов в Python. Python также предоставляет возможность подключаться к базам данных и выполнять запросы, что делает его мощным инструментом для работы с данными.

3. SQL (Structured Query Language)

SQL — это язык запросов, который используется для работы с базами данных. Хотя Excel не является полноценной базой данных, он поддерживает функциональность SQL и может выполнять запросы к данным. SQL позволяет извлекать, обновлять и удалять данные, а также создавать таблицы и индексы в Excel. Это может быть полезно в ситуациях, когда необходимо выполнить сложные операции с данными.

Независимо от выбранного языка программирования, важно учитывать свои потребности и требования проекта. Каждый из этих языков имеет свои преимущества и ограничения, и выбор должен быть основан на конкретных задачах и целях программиста. Определение, какой язык программирования лучше всего подходит для работы с базами данных в Excel, требует некоторого исследования и изучения функциональности и возможностей каждого языка.

Как создать базу данных в Excel с использованием программирования

Первый шаг – определение структуры вашей базы данных. Это включает определение таблиц и полей, которые будут хранить вашу информацию. Вы можете использовать стандартные функции Excel для создания таблиц и определения типов данных для различных полей. Например, вы можете создать таблицу для хранения информации о клиентах с полями, такими как имя, фамилия, адрес и телефонный номер.

Следующий шаг – создание пользовательской формы для ввода данных в базу. Это можно сделать с помощью инструментов программирования Excel, таких как Visual Basic for Applications (VBA). Пользовательская форма позволяет вам создать удобный интерфейс для ввода и редактирования данных. Вы можете добавить различные элементы управления, такие как текстовые поля, флажки и кнопки.

  • Добавьте кнопку «Добавить» для вставки новой записи в базу данных.
  • Добавьте кнопку «Редактировать», которая позволяет вам изменить существующие записи.
  • Добавьте кнопку «Удалить», чтобы удалить запись из базы данных.

Когда пользователь заполняет форму и нажимает кнопку «Добавить», данные добавляются в соответствующую таблицу в Excel. Вы можете использовать язык программирования VBA для написания кода, который будет выполнять операции вставки, обновления и удаления данных. Например, чтобы вставить новую запись, вы можете использовать команду SQL INSERT INTO.

Это только небольшой обзор процесса создания базы данных в Excel с использованием программирования. С помощью программирования вы можете добавить другие функции, такие как сортировка и фильтрация данных, создание отчетов и даже подключение к внешним базам данных. Excel является мощным инструментом для работы с данными, и использование программирования дает вам дополнительные возможности для автоматизации и оптимизации ваших задач.

Читайте также:  Антивирус рекомендованный windows 7

Основные функции и методы программирования баз данных в Excel

1. Создание таблиц: Одной из основных функций программирования баз данных в Excel является создание таблиц. Excel предоставляет возможность создавать таблицы и определять различные типы данных для каждого столбца. Это позволяет упростить организацию данных и обеспечить легкий доступ к ним.

2. Управление данными: Excel также предлагает множество функций для управления данными в базе данных. Вы можете редактировать, добавлять или удалять данные, сортировать и фильтровать таблицы, а также применять различные формулы и функции для обработки данных.

3. Создание запросов: Еще одной функцией программирования баз данных в Excel является возможность создания запросов. Вы можете создавать запросы для извлечения нужной информации из базы данных, выбирая определенные строки и столбцы или применяя различные условия.

4. Макросы: Excel поддерживает создание макросов, которые упрощают и автоматизируют выполнение определенных задач. Макросы позволяют записывать и воспроизводить серию действий, что экономит время и усилия пользователя.

В целом, программирование баз данных в Excel предоставляет широкий спектр возможностей для работы с данными. Он дает пользователю полный контроль над управлением, редактированием и анализом данных, что делает его неотъемлемым инструментом для множества задач. Независимо от того, нужно ли вам управление клиентской базой данных или анализ данных по продукту, Excel может предложить решение для ваших потребностей.

Практические примеры программирования баз данных в Excel

Один из примеров — создание базы данных клиентов. Вы можете использовать Excel для сохранения информации о своих клиентах, таких как их имена, контактные данные, даты покупок и другие подробности. С помощью программирования в Excel вы можете легко добавлять и изменять данные, а также выполнять поиск и фильтровать информацию в соответствии с вашими потребностями.

Другой пример — создание базы данных товаров. Вы можете использовать Excel для отслеживания своего товарного ассортимента, включая наименования, цены, количество на складе и другие характеристики товаров. С помощью программирования в Excel вы можете создать функции для автоматического подсчета общего количества товаров, суммарной стоимости и других расчетов.

Также стоит отметить, что программирование баз данных в Excel может быть полезным при анализе данных. Вы можете использовать формулы и функции Excel для создания отчетов и сводных таблиц на основе данных в вашей базе данных. Это поможет вам наглядно представить информацию и выделить ключевые тенденции и показатели.

В целом, программирование баз данных в Excel представляет собой мощный инструмент для организации и анализа данных. С помощью приведенных выше примеров вы сможете эффективно управлять информацией и получать ценные инсайты для принятия решений.

Оцените статью